預計2023年飛機數駕駛座市場價值將達78.1億美元,2024年將達85.9億美元,年複合成長率為10.56%,到2030年將達到157.9億美元。

主要市場統計數據
基準年 2023 年 78.1億美元
預計 2024 年 85.9億美元
預測年份 2030 157.9億美元
複合年成長率(%) 10.56%

在當今的航空業中,數駕駛座正在成為一股革命性的力量,重新定義飛行員與飛機的互動方式。現代數駕駛座整合了先進的電子設備、直覺的軟體和高性能感測器,為飛行員提供了無縫介面,大大增強了情境察覺和決策能力。這種轉變不僅僅是更換模擬儀器的問題;它是對更高精度、更強安全通訊協定和更高營運效率的需求所推動的演變。

數位駕駛座將關鍵飛行資料和即時環境資訊結合到一個顯示器中,即使在緊張的飛行條件下也能進行快速評估。隨著全球航空趨勢轉向自動化和資料主導決策,數位駕駛座處於技術整合的前沿。其設計著重於人體工學介面,減少飛行員的工作量並在動態變化的操作需求下最佳化性能。

這些駕駛座的到來進一步彰顯了航空業對營運安全性和可靠性的承諾。增強的連接性、強大的處理能力和創新的軟體解決方案相結合,創造了一個以技術精度為基礎的人類直覺的生態系統。本介紹為深入探討數位轉型如何重塑航空業、帶來直接利益和長期戰略優勢奠定了基礎。

The Aircraft Digital Cockpit Market was valued at USD 7.81 billion in 2023 and is projected to grow to USD 8.59 billion in 2024, with a CAGR of 10.56%, reaching USD 15.79 billion by 2030.

KEY MARKET STATISTICS
Base Year [2023] USD 7.81 billion
Estimated Year [2024] USD 8.59 billion
Forecast Year [2030] USD 15.79 billion
CAGR (%) 10.56%

In today's aviation landscape, the digital cockpit is emerging as a revolutionary force that is redefining how pilots interact with their aircraft. Modern digital cockpits integrate advanced electronics, intuitive software, and high-performance sensors to provide pilots with a seamless interface, greatly enhancing situational awareness and decision-making. This transformation is not simply about replacing analog instruments; it is an evolution driven by the demand for enhanced precision, robust safety protocols, and improved operational efficiency.

Digital cockpits merge critical flight data with real-time environmental information into one unified display, allowing for rapid assessments during high-stress flight conditions. As global aviation trends shift towards increased automation and data-driven decision-making, the digital cockpit stands at the forefront of technology integration. Its design emphasizes ergonomic interfaces, which reduce pilot workload and optimize performance under dynamically changing operational demands.

The emergence of these cockpits further underscores the industry's commitment to operational safety and reliability. Enhanced connectivity, powerful processing capabilities, and innovative software solutions combine to create an ecosystem where human intuition is supported by technological precision. This introduction sets the stage for a deeper exploration into how digital transformation is reshaping aviation, delivering both immediate benefits and long-term strategic advantages.

Transformative Shifts in the Aviation Landscape

Over the past few years, the aircraft digital cockpit has undergone transformative shifts that mirror the broader digital revolution in aviation. Traditional analog interfaces are being supplanted by sophisticated digital systems that offer unparalleled clarity and data integration. This evolution is a response to a host of factors, including advancements in microelectronics, the integration of artificial intelligence, and enhanced software capabilities that provide real-time analytics.

As manufacturers and aerospace engineers work to meet regulatory demands and growing passenger expectations, digital cockpits have become more adaptable and resilient. They not only streamline flight operations but also empower pilots with comprehensive, actionable information. The integration of high-resolution displays and advanced sensor technologies has enabled these cockpits to anticipate potential faults and propose immediate corrective actions.

Furthermore, changing consumer demands and heightened global competition have spurred investment in research and development, driving further innovation in cockpit design. These shifts are fundamentally altering the way airlines approach safety, efficiency, and overall aircraft performance. The convergence of these trends points to an industry that is not only embracing change but is also actively reengineering its infrastructure to capitalize on the benefits of digital modernization.

Key Segmentation Insights Unveiled

A closer examination of the market reveals detailed segmentation insights that are reshaping the aircraft digital cockpit landscape. When considering components, the market is intricately studied across elements such as control panels, displays, sensors, and software. Control panels have evolved to include both keypad models and highly responsive touchscreen panels, along with the rising trend of voice-activated controls. The display segment has diversified to feature head-up display systems, multifunctional displays, primary flight displays, and interactive touchscreen panels-each designed to enhance the overall user experience. Sensors too have seen significant segmentation, spanning from position sensors that monitor precise aircraft coordinates to proximity sensors that ensure safety during critical flight moments. Software in digital cockpits is no less critical, with functionalities distributed across autopilot systems, communication modules, and sophisticated navigation software.

Beyond the hardware and software components, the market is segmented by platform type, which investigates fixed-wing aircraft, rotary-wing aircraft, and unmanned aerial vehicles. Fixed-wing aircraft are further analyzed by narrowing down into narrow-body jets and wide-body jets, each with unique operational requirements and integration challenges. Connectivity solutions have also become a focal point, with satellite communications providing reliable global connectivity, while wireless solutions, driven by Bluetooth technology and Wi-Fi systems, offer flexibility and ease of integration.

The application of these digital systems also varies, with different usage scenarios defining the market. For instance, fleet management relies on aircraft tracking and maintenance scheduling, flight operations incorporate communication, flight control and navigation enhancements, and flight training benefits from simulators and virtual reality systems. Lastly, the end-user segment encompasses charter operators, commercial airlines, and defense organizations, each further subdivided into specialized categories such as corporate and leisure charters, freight and passenger airlines, as well as air forces and naval air wings. These layered segments provide a comprehensive picture of a market that is as complex as it is dynamic.
